/* CSS Document */


/*///////////////////////////////////////////////////////////////////////////////////// Listado y Detalles*/
#contentEvents {
	float: left;
	width: 740px;
}
#contentEvents h1 {
	color: #FFFFFF;
	font-size: 16px;
	padding: 6px 10px 5px 10px;
	border-bottom: solid 1px #FFFFFF;
	letter-spacing: 2px;
	margin: 0 0 20px 0;
}

/*///////////////////////////////////////////////////////////////////////////////////// Listado*/


.note {
	margin: 10px;
	font-size: 13px;
	color: #fff;
	text-align: center;
}


#eventsMonth { float: right; width: 520px; }
#eventsMonth h3 { color: #E57409; font-size: 14px;	padding: 6px 10px 5px 10px; border-bottom: solid 1px #fff; letter-spacing: 2px; }
#eventsMonth .box {	padding: 10px 0 0 0;	background-color: #080808; border: solid 1px #292929; margin-bottom: 15px; }
#eventsMonth .post { padding: 15px 15px 15px 20px; }
#eventsMonth .info { float: right; width: 330px; }
#eventsMonth .info a { color: #E57409; }
#eventsMonth .name { font-size: 13px; font-weight: bold; margin: 2px 0 5px 0; background: url(../images/flecha4.gif) no-repeat; padding: 0 0 0 20px; }
#eventsMonth .details { font-size: 12px; background: url(../images/flecha.gif) no-repeat; margin-left: 5px; padding: 0 0 4px 15px; }
#eventsMonth .address { color:#999999; font-size: 11px; padding: 0; }
#eventsMonth .text { font-size: 12px; padding: 10px; }

#eventsMonth .logo {
	position: relative;
	float: left;
}
#eventsMonth .logo img {
	border: solid 1px #666;
}
#eventsMonth .logo span {
	width: 126px;
	height: 40px;
	display: block;
	position: absolute;
	top: -12px;
	left: -15px;
	background: url(../images/listaAcceso.png) no-repeat;
	z-index:100;
}

#cal {
	font-size:12px; 
	color:#000000;
	margin-bottom: 15px;
}

#eventsDay {
	float:left;
	width: 200px;
}
#eventsDay .post {
	margin: 15px;
	font-size: 13px;
	padding-bottom: 10px;
	border-bottom: dotted #999999 1px;
	color: #FFFFFF;
}
#eventsDay .post a{
	color: #E57409;
}
#eventsDay img {
	width: 120px;
	border: solid 1px #FFFFFF;
	margin: 10px 0 0 20px;
}
#eventsDay .name {
	font-size: 13px;
	font-weight: bold;
	margin: 7px 0 5px 0;
	background: url(../images/flecha4.gif) no-repeat;
	padding-left: 20px;
}
#eventsDay .details {
	font-size: 13px;
	background: url(../images/flecha.gif) no-repeat;
	margin-left: 5px;
	padding-left: 15px;
}

.element {
	background:#FFFFFF;	
	color: #000000;
	padding: 5px;
} 
.element p {
	margin: 0;
	padding: 5px;
} 


/*///////////////////////////////////////////////////////////////////////////////////// Detalles*/
#contentEventA {
	float: left;
	width: 300px;
}

#contentEventB {
	float: right;
	width: 420px;
}

#flayer {
	float: left;
	width: 300px;
	background-image: url(../images/sidebarFoot.jpg);
	background-color: #FFFFFF;
	background-repeat: no-repeat;
	background-position: bottom;
	text-align: center;
	padding-bottom: 65px;
}
#flayer h2 {
	color: #000000;
	font-size: 16px;
	background-image: url(../images/sidebarTitle.jpg);
	padding-top: 6px;
	padding-right: 10px;
	padding-left: 10px;
	height: 26px;
	font-weight: bold;
	word-spacing: normal;
	letter-spacing: 2px;
	margin-bottom: 8px;
	text-align: left;
}

#contentEventC { text-align:justify; }
#contentEventC.widthPhotos { width:570px; }

#contentEvents .name {
	font-size: 14px;
	font-weight: bold;
	margin: 0 0 7px 0;
	background: url(../images/flecha4.gif) no-repeat;
	padding-left: 20px;
	color: #E57409;
}
#contentEventA a,
#contentEventB a,
#contentEventC a{
	color: #E57409;
}
#contentEventA p,
#contentEventB p,
#contentEventC p {
	font-size: 13px;
	background: url(../images/flecha.gif) no-repeat;
	margin-left: 5px;
	padding-left: 15px;
}
#contentEventA strong,
#contentEventB strong,
#contentEventA b,
#contentEventB b,
#contentEventC strong,
#contentEventC b {
	color: #E57409;
}
#contentEventA .text p,
#contentEventB .text p,
#contentEventC .text p{
	padding-bottom: 10px;
}

#info {	
	text-align: justify;
	font-size: 13px;
}

#nextEvents {
	font-size: 13px;
}
#nextEvents .post {	
	color: #FFFFFF;
	width: 180px;
	padding-right:5px;
	float: left;
}
#nextEvents .post a {
	color: #E57409;
}
#nextEvents img {
	width: 120px;
	border: solid 1px #FFFFFF;
	margin: 10px 0 0 20px;
}
#nextEvents .name {
	font-size: 13px;
	font-weight: bold;
	margin: 0 0 5px 0;
	background: url(../images/flecha4.gif) no-repeat;
	padding-left: 20px;
	text-align:left;
}
#nextEvents .details {
	font-size: 13px;
	background: url(../images/flecha.gif) no-repeat;
	margin-left: 5px;
	padding-left: 15px;
}
#nextEvents .note {
	text-align: right;
	padding-bottom: 100px;
}

#contentEventsAlbum { float:right; width:150px; }
#contentEventsAlbum .thumbs {list-style:none;}
#contentEventsAlbum .thumbs li{ margin:0 0 10px 10px; text-align:center;}
#contentEventsAlbum .thumbs img{border:#aaaaaa solid 1px; width:110px;}


/*///////////////////////////////////////////////////////////////////////////////////// Fotos*/

#infoEvent {
	float: left;
	width: 300px;
	background: url(../images/sidebarFoot.jpg) #FFFFFF no-repeat bottom;
	padding-bottom: 65px;
	text-align: center;
}
#infoEvent h2 {
	color: #000000;
	font-size: 16px;
	background-image: url(../images/sidebarTitle.jpg);
	padding: 6px 10px 0 10px;
	height: 26px;
	font-weight: bold;
	word-spacing: normal;
	letter-spacing: 2px;
	text-align: left;
}
#infoEvent .name {
	color: #000000;
	font-size: 14px;
	font-weight: bold;
	margin: 7px 0 5px 7px;
	background: url(../images/flecha4.gif) no-repeat;
	padding-left: 20px;
	text-align: left;
}



#readMe {
	float: right;
	width: 420px;
}

